Openwrt APs can happily live in dumb ap/ wired extender configuration and non-openwrt firewall managing network details. You will need sime rockchip or filogic device to do gigabit+gigabit forwsrding, 10-15Wpower. Also check protexli for purpose built pc-router or search this forum about bolting real multiport netcard in 2nd hand nettop/thin client machines.
I currently use a DIY small form factor device with 4 interfaces as a boundry router running Internet <-> Openwrt <---> DMZ <----> OpnSense <---> secured segments. The DMZ is where all my WiFi Gets dumped from my house / guests IoT and others, the OpnSense is where everything like my PC's my media devices and such go in different VLANs. Of course the requirement is that you must have a Switch that supports VLANs and such.
